#967b0b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#967b0b is composed of 58.8% red, 48.2%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 48.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 31.6%. #967b0b color hex could be obtained by blending #fff616 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#967b0b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#967b0b has RGB values of R:150, G:123,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.93,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9861899.

Shades and Tints of #967b0b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fefbf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#967b0b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52514f is the less saturated color, while #9c7f05 is the most saturated one.
